The Significance of Power-Ups and Coin Collection
While avoiding traffic is paramount, accumulating coins and power-ups dramatically enhances the gameplay experience. Coins serve as the in-game currency, allowing players to unlock new chicken skins and various enhancements. These cosmetic customizations don't affect gameplay, but inject an element of personalization and reward progression. Power-ups, on the other hand, offer tangible advantages. Magnets attract nearby coins, shields temporarily protect against collisions, and speed boosts grant a momentary advantage in outpacing the relentless traffic. Strategically utilizing power-ups at opportune moments can significantly extend a player's run and drastically increase their score. Learning which power-ups best suit different playstyles is an important aspect of mastering the game.
| Magnet | Attracts nearby coins | 5-10 seconds |
| Shield | Protects against one collision | Instantaneous |
| Speed Boost | Increases chicken’s speed | 3-5 seconds |
| Double Coins | Doubles the value of collected coins | 10-15 seconds |
Beyond strategic power-up usage, adept coin collection becomes a vital skill. Efficiently charting a course that maximizes coin acquisition without compromising safety is a challenging balancing act. Players quickly learn to prioritize coins located within safe pathways, while deftly avoiding risky maneuvers for a few extra coins. This adds another layer of skill expression to the game.

Strategic Approaches to Maximizing Your Score
Achieving a high score in this game requires more than just quick reflexes; it necessitates a strategic mindset. Players should prioritize consistent survival over reckless coin collection. A single collision can instantly end a run, negating any potential gains from a risky maneuver. Therefore, focusing on identifying safe paths and avoiding unnecessary risks is paramount. Mastering the game's visual cues – anticipating vehicle movements and recognizing patterns – is essential for formulating a sound strategy. Furthermore, understanding the timing and effectiveness of power-ups is crucial. Save shields for particularly challenging sections, and utilize speed boosts to quickly traverse lengthy stretches of road.
Analyzing Traffic Patterns and Safe Zones
Observing the game’s traffic patterns is a key element in maximizing your score. The game isn’t entirely random; certain vehicle types and speeds appear repeatedly. Learning these patterns allows players to predict upcoming obstacles and plan their movements accordingly. Many players discover and exploit specific "safe zones" – recurring gaps in the traffic flow – that allow for prolonged advancement. Recognizing these zones and positioning the chicken to take advantage of them is a fundamental technique for experienced players. Analyzing the spacing between vehicles is also crucial; even a seemingly small gap can provide enough room to maneuver to safety.
